Episode 1976: September 2024 New Music 7: The Courettes, Kit Sebastian, Nick Lowe

Bill Mulligan hops on board the September 2024 New Music Train today and heads across the pond to pick up a friend of his, whom you might know. The pair discuss new music from The Courettes, Kit Sebastian and Nick Lowe.
